Show Distf Scout Committee Reorganized; Nolan Weight Named New Chairman Nolan Weight has been elected district Scout chairman succeeding Freeman Bird, it was announced an-nounced Wednesday following a district committee meeting and annual election. Others named to a.ssi.st with the Scout work are: William Witney, vice-chairman; Ashley Graham, health and safety chairman; Verl Whiting, finance chairman; Freeman Free-man Bird, camping and activity; R. L. Wilson, leadership training; Ray Clark, advancement chairman Wilford Manwaring, organization and extension; El wood Loveridge, district commissioner. It was decided at the meeting that the Scout drive should get underway immediately with Finance Fin-ance Chairman Whiting in charge ; of arrangements. j Also in connection with the University Un-iversity of Scouting being held in Provo, it was stated that Springville Spring-ville rated first in attendance the first evening and second in the second. Another meeting is scheduled sched-uled this evening and it is hoped that a full attendance of Scoutcrs and MIA presidents attend. Thus-far Thus-far in the meeting, there has not been a single MIA president from Springville in attendance. It is hoped that this record will also be broken tonight, scout officials stated. |
